Cyanide solutions used for heap leaching are made up of sodium cyanide (NaCN). The sodium cyanide solution ([NaCN]-total = 0.01 M) is kept at pH 10.4. The pH is kept high to keep the cyanide in the CN- form. If CN protonates by the reverse of the HCN dissociation reaction,

HCN = H+ + CN- pKa = 9.24

and forms HCN, it will volatilize, and if it volatilizes, HCN can poison mine workers. At pH 10.4, what fraction of the cyanide is in the CN- form?

Calculate the fraction as [CN-] / [NaCN]-total.
